The news website reports that on the third anniversary of the failed coup in Turkey, Turkish authorities have warned Kosovo about the threat coming from the movement of Turkish Islamic scholar and preacher, Fethullah Gulen. Ankara accuses his movement – Hizmet – of the failed coup in 2016. The Turkish Ambassador to Pristina said on Monday that Kosovo must not allow this organisation, “which is no less dangerous than the Islamic State, to turn Kosovo’s children into enemies of this country”.
